TLDSB: Current weather, road conditions, and weather forecasts all play a factor in school bus cancellations

TLDSB is shedding some light on how the decision is made to cancel school buses. Trillium Lakelands District School Board Communications Officer, Laura Blaker, says the decision is made based on a number of factors. Inclement weather, current road conditions, and weather forecasts all go into the decision.

Blaker says student safety is the board’s guiding principle in the decision. The TLDSB Superintendent of Business makes the call, in consultation with the Transportation Supervisor, and local bus operators.

Blaker says a decision is usually made by about 6:30am in order to get the word out.

When it comes to exams, Blaker says the board has a process in place in case there are snow days on exam dates. If that happens, the schedule is moved forward by one day.
